WebMar 4, 2024 · C.S. Lewis was born in November 29, 1898, in Belfast, Ireland as Clive Staples Lewis. Clive was an imaginative child. When he was just a little boy, his dog, Jacksie, was killed by a car. From then on, Clive wanted to be called “Jacksie”, after his pet.He was known as Jack among his friends and family for the rest of his life. WebMar 19, 2024 · Elder Neal L.
